Nanomagnetic fluid (ferromagnetic nanoparticles) has been evaluated as a corrosion inhibitor and the corrosion behavior of carbon steel in 1 M sulfuric acid (H2SO4) has been studied. The nanomagnetic luid was synthesized to achieve stability in acidic media when it is mixed with H2SO4. Inhibition followed a Langmuir adsoprtion isotherm.
